Materials

Depending on the manufacturer and style, double glazing installation near me glazed windows come with different insulation materials. The frames for windows are made from uPVC which is extremely durable and provides excellent insulation and lasts long. It is also easy to maintain and resistant to humidity and corrosion. uPVC is available in a variety of colors and finishes, making it simple for homeowners to choose the perfect style to match their home.

Insulation is an essential feature of double glazed windows, as they reduce heat loss by as much as 50%. This helps keep your house warm in the winter and cool in summer, reducing energy costs. They can also help to reduce noise from outside, and create a more relaxing living space inside your home.

The air gap between the two panes of glass is usually filled with argon or krypton gas to increase the efficiency of the window by as much as five times. This will lower your energy bills and ensure that your heating and cooling systems are working to their maximum potential. Double-glazed windows can also protect your family from harmful UV rays, protecting your furniture and carpets from sun damage.

Insurance

Double glazing window installers require insurance policies that are appropriate. This includes public liability as well as tools cover. These kinds of policies ensure the company's protection in the event of an accident or damage to property belonging to a client as well as securing the equipment used by the glazier. If, for example, an employee cuts themselves when handling a piece of glass, double glazed window installers it can result in expensive medical treatment as well as time off from work. Public liability insurance covers the cost of compensation to the employee, making sure that the business is not left with a financial burden.

Employers' liability insurance is also required for double glazing companies. This is legally required for any business that employs staff. Glaziers and window installers must also offer their employees personal accident and illness insurance. This type of insurance protects a tradesman if he or she is injured or becomes ill when working for a company. It can also help pay their salary in the event they are in a position of no work because of injury or illness.
